Abstract

Objective This study aims to investigate the factors influencing the adoption of electronic Personal Health Records (ePHR) among China’s aging “new silver” generation, with a focus on understanding how user interface (UI) design affects older users’ adoption intentions. Methods An extended Unified Theory of Acceptance and Use of Technology (UTAUT) model, incorporating elements from the Technology Acceptance Model (TAM), was used as the analytical framework. The model also includes seven key UI design characteristics. A total of 420 valid responses were collected through online questionnaires and snowball sampling. Structural equation modeling (SEM) was applied to analyze the data. Results The analysis revealed that behavioral intention (BI) to adopt ePHR was most strongly influenced by perceived ease of use (PEOU; β = 0.218, p = 0.002). Performance expectancy, effort expectancy, perceived usefulness (PU), and self-efficacy were also found to be significant predictors. Among the UI design features, platform features (E1) significantly impacted PEOU, PU, and BI. Additionally, font clarity (E2), color and icon features (E3), operational cognition (E5), and feedback perception (E4) all had significant positive effects on PU, PEOU, and BI. Information retrieval features (E6) influenced PU and PEOU, but had a minor impact on BI. Conclusion The findings highlight the relevance of the UTAUT model in the context of digital health adoption among older users, emphasizing the importance of user interface design in shaping adoption intentions. The study underscores the need for tailoring ePHR systems to meet the specific needs of older individuals and provides practical recommendations for improving inclusive digital health solutions.
